The Cultural Significance of the Date

May 3rd isn't just about horses and hats. In many parts of the world, it’s World Press Freedom Day. This isn't just a Hallmark holiday; it was established by the UN General Assembly back in 1993. It’s a day for journalists and activists to reflect on the state of the free press. Given the political climate we’re seeing globally as we head into 2025 and 2026, this day carries a lot of weight.

For some, it’s the Feast of the Finding of the True Cross. In Poland and Japan, it’s a massive day for different reasons. Japan celebrates Constitution Memorial Day, which is part of their "Golden Week." This is huge. If you are planning to travel to Japan around May 3rd, 2025, be prepared for crowds like you’ve never seen. Trains will be packed. Restaurants will have lines out the door. It is arguably the busiest time for domestic travel in Japan.

Historical Context: What Usually Happens Around This Time?

Looking back at history helps us understand the "vibe" of May 3rd. It’s the day Margaret Thatcher became the first female Prime Minister of the UK in 1979. It’s the day the first Sears Catalog was published in 1888. It’s a day of beginnings.

In terms of weather patterns, May 3rd is often a transitional period. In the US Midwest, it’s the start of the heavy tornado season. In the UK, it’s usually the "Early May Bank Holiday" weekend—though in 2025, that actual holiday Monday falls on May 5th.

You’ve got a three-day weekend for many people, which is why May 3rd is such a popular date for festivals.
